      @UltraStar The names that you see on the route points is because there was an update in the RoutePlanner some months ago. This update uses dynamic names instead of the road names and it has nothing to do with placing route points off of the road. Having said that, it is always good practice to place route points accurately on the track line and away from roundabouts, viaducts and road junctions.
